Anyone ever made sweet potato pancakes? Here is a good recipe to try
Sweet Potato Pancakes
Author: Sinful Nutrition
Recipe type: Breakfast
Serves: 3-4 pancakes
Ingredients
1 small sweet potato
2 eggs
1 tsp vanilla extract*
½ tsp cinnamon*
*optional
Instructions
Rinse and pierce sweet potato with a fork.
Microwave on high for 3 minutes, or until tender.
Let cool, and peel off skin.
Add flesh of sweet potato to blender.
Add eggs, and optional ingredients if using, and blend until smooth.
Heat a large skillet over medium-low heat.
Coat with non-stick spray.
Pour batter into 2-inch diameter circles in skillet.
Let cook 2-3 minutes, or until brown, flip, and cook an additional 1-2 minutes.
Top with butter, maple syrup, and cinnamon if desired.
